Transaction c28fba6170146ffa5f739a35f72810ea75c94e9bab3a1842b46037619385146d

2 Input
2 Outputs
  • c28fba6170146ffa5f739a35f72810ea75c94e9bab3a1842b46037619385146d:0
  • value  938960
    address  1EC9VKmB9C1arRkRNinLeoQ2HmRMXyRwBD
  • c28fba6170146ffa5f739a35f72810ea75c94e9bab3a1842b46037619385146d:1
  • value  29953198
    address  1Cf9wmDXEGDyhPqVZTjjCuHFBUrwETrQ3s